About Converting Imperial quart per Minutes to Bushels per Millisecond

Imperial quart per Minutes and Bushel per Millisecond both measure volumetric flow rate — how much volume passes a point over time — used to size pipes and pumps, monitor river or stream discharge, control industrial processes, and set medical infusion rates. Both are volumetric flow rate units.

Formula

bushels per millisecond = imperial quart per minutes × 5.375296e-7

This factor comes from each unit's defined relationship to the category's base unit: 1 imperial quart per minutes equals 0.0000189420416667 base units, and 1 bushel per millisecond equals 35.2390701669 base units, so dividing one by the other gives the direct imperial quart per minutes-to-bushel per millisecond factor of 5.375296e-7.

What's the difference between volumetric and mass flow rate?

Volumetric flow rate measures the volume of fluid passing a point per unit time (for example, liters per second). Mass flow rate measures the mass instead. For a fluid of constant density the two are directly proportional, but for compressible fluids like gases, mass flow is often the more meaningful quantity.
